− | The banner.bin and icon.bin files are LZ77 compressed U8 archives themselves, each with an IMD5 header, containing the MD5 of the file. sound.bin has an IMD5 header, and can be of at least 3 formats, BNS (which has INFO and DATA sections), LZ77 compressed RIFF (wav), and uncompressed RIFF. | + | The banner.bin and icon.bin files are LZ77 compressed U8 archives themselves, each with an IMD5 header, containing the MD5 of the file. sound.bin has an IMD5 header, and can be of at least 3 formats, BNS (which has INFO and DATA sections), RIFF (wav), and AIFF. (RIFF and AIFF have been seen LZ77 compressed) |

| + | ==brlan Files== |
| | | |
| The brlan files (located in the "anim" folder), are some kind of animation scripts. There could be multiple scripts, for example: | | The brlan files (located in the "anim" folder), are some kind of animation scripts. There could be multiple scripts, for example: |
| Banner_Start.brlan | | Banner_Start.brlan |
| Banner_Loop.brlan | | Banner_Loop.brlan |
− | The scripts doesn't use the names of the TPL-files when using images in the animation, instead it uses names which are defined in the blyt-file. The blyt-file contains information about every object, what file it is in, index in file (a TPL can hold more than 1 picture), plus a bunch of unknown properties. | + | The scripts doesn't use the names of the TPL-files when using images in the animation, instead it uses names which are defined in the blyt-file. |
| + | |
| + | Currently the following info has been worked out from the file used in the icon.bin (banner.bin should be similar) (this is from looking at the file in a standard hex editor - e.g WinHex): |
| + | <pre> |
| + | First Line: |
| + | first 8 bytes RLAN FE FF 00 08 |
| + | next 4 bytes = Size of data from RLAN (inclusive) |
| + | next 2 bytes = Offset to first "section"? (so far 00 10 only) |
| + | next 2 bytes = 00 01 = not sure |
| + | |
| + | 2nd Line: |
| + | first 4 bytes = pai1 |
| + | next 4 bytes = size of section |
| + | next 4 bytes........ |
| + | RRR - 09 60 01 00 |
| + | SPM - 03 20 01 00 |
| + | MOH2- 02 B2 01 00 |
| + | NMH - 00 78 01 00 |
| + | |
| + | next 4 bytes = number of brlyt image references (00 00 00 01 for RRR, 00 00 00 03 for SPM, 00 00 00 02 for MOH2) |
| + | |
| + | |
| + | 3rd line: |
| + | First 4 bytes = unknown, so far has been |
| + | 00 00 00 14 |
| + | Next 4 bytes * brlyt image references = unknown, Offset (from p in pai1) to first name of some sort? (name that is in BRLYT file). |
| + | </pre> |

| + | ==brlyt Files== |
| + | The blyt-file contains information about every object, what file it is in, index in file (a TPL can hold more than 1 picture), plus a bunch of unknown properties. |
| I've also found if-statements in the bottom of the .brlyt file. They change the objects depending on what language your system uses (either TM or (R)). | | I've also found if-statements in the bottom of the .brlyt file. They change the objects depending on what language your system uses (either TM or (R)). |
| + | |
| + | The data structure worked out so far has been (as with brlan, only icon.bin has been used so far): |
| + | <pre> |
| + | First Line: |
| + | first 8 bytes RLYT FE FF 08 |
| + | next 4 bytes = size of data including RLYT |
| + | next 2 bytes = offset to first section (00 10) |
| + | next 2 bytes = unsure: |
| + | RRR - 00 09 |
| + | SPM - 00 0B |
| + | MOH2- 00 0B |
| + | NMH - 00 09 |
| + | |
| + | 2nd line: |
| + | first 4 bytes = lyt1 |
| + | next 4 bytes = size of lyt1 |
| + | next 8 bytes = seems to always be |
| + | 01 00 00 00 44 18 00 00 |
| + | |
| + | 3rd line: |
| + | first 4 bytes (continuation of last 8 bytes?): |
| + | 43 E4 00 00 |
| + | next 4 bytes: txl1 |
| + | next 4 bytes: size of txl1 |
| + | next 2 bytes: number of files |
| + | next 2 bytes: 00 00 |
| + | 4th Line: |
| + | next 4 bytes * number of files = offset of names |
| + | |
| + | |
| + | From txl1 + size of txl1: |
| + | mat1 |
| + | Next 4 bytes: Size of mat1. |
| + | Next 2 bytes: number of "Pictures" |
| + | Next 2 bytes: nulls |
| + | Next 4 bytes * number of pictures: offset of picture names. |
| + | Not sure on the rest at the moment |
| + | |
| + | |
| + | From mat1 + size of mat1. |
| + | pan1 |
| + | Next 4 bytes: Size of pan1. (always 4c?) |
| + | Next 4 bytes: 01 04 FF 00 ? |
| + | Next x bytes: RootPane usually + ?? |
| + | |
| + | |
| + | From pan1 + Size of pan1. |
| + | pas1 |
| + | Next 4 bytes: Size of pas1 (has been 8 pan1 + 4 bytes for size) |
| + | |
| + | |
| + | From pas1 + size of pas1 |
| + | bnd1 or pic1 |
| + | |
| + | |
| + | bnd1 |
| + | Next 4 bytes: Size of bnd1 |
| + | Next 4 bytes: 01 04 FF 00 ?? |
| + | </pre> |
